February 9, 2011 (Naperville, IL) – In 2010, UL made significant changes to UL’s 2054 battery pack requirements that may impact current UL 2054 approved product. The new requirements are mainly intended to:
The effective date for compliance to the new standards is rapidly approaching. Both old and new products that do not comply with the new requirements by November 1, 2011 will likely need to have their UL markings removed by that date. Furthermore, noncompliant products will be deleted from UL’s database.
Although the effective date for compliance is November 2011, UL’s
cutoff date to receive samples, specifications and documents is May
2011. If you believe your company’s product no longer complies,
IQL recommends that you contact your UL representative immediately
